Output 86be052553868bc5fc9a045836cfdcc36b57b3a5e7e3f9f6c8077bd6f383f96a:0

value
1073950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f98b94677f19c1d5799fbc8ed677b7fddb2c32 OP_EQUAL
address
3HTd6FBdxLJon2Zi6zpRCYdybt8bbQ1uyY
transaction
86be052553868bc5fc9a045836cfdcc36b57b3a5e7e3f9f6c8077bd6f383f96a
spent
true